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
096 97160 48820
210604556 01 419928
210604556 01 419928
20897 049 56 05149 8734
All about undefined
Interested in learning more?
210604556 01 419928
20897 049 56 05149 8734
See more
252 49722625582 05726069610
447 891 2455612
See more
3094 14161996
710702 74 01997061 2902605406 435016
See more